| Abstract: | One of the cornerstones of social housing is tenant participation. Changes to service delivery are subject to genuine consultation with the people it affects. This, the article argues, has been forgotten in the rush to introduce floating support. Referring to the current research that Help the Aged is undertaking based on tenants' concerns, the article argues that greater understanding of the consequences of floating support for people's lives is needed before this new model becomes irreversibly widespread. |
